WebSep 30, 2024 · Below is an example of a letter addressed to a large group of people at the same address: Members of the Admissions Board Admissions Department University of Richfield 1234 Learning Lane, Suit 900 Richfield, WI 55440 Dear Members of the Admissions Board: Tips for addressing letters to multiple people WebMar 4, 2024 · The most widely used salutation is “ Dear, ” and is recommended if you’ve never met the intended recipient. The salutation is followed by the person’s name and punctuated with a colon or comma. If …
